Buying Guide
Before you click buy, spend a few minutes thinking through the practical details that make décor work in an apartment bedroom. Consider scale: how long is the wall, how high is the ceiling, and how much visual weight do you want to add? For string lights and garlands, measure the run you want to cover and add a little slack for draping. If you’re renting, prioritize damage-free mounting options: removable hooks, Command strips, and self-adhesive shelves that rely on strong adhesives rather than drilling.
Power and control matter. USB-powered lights (or battery options) are convenient when outlets are limited; remote and timer features make nightly use effortless. For faux plants, look at pack lengths and leaf density—thicker garlands hide behind-the-scenes cords better and read as more realistic on camera. Wall art prints should be measured against frames or gallery-wall layouts—unframed 8x10s are inexpensive and easy to swap.
Think about multi-functionality. A bedside shelf that doubles as a nightstand substitute or phone docking station is more valuable in a studio than a decorative-only piece. When selecting finishes (black wood, warm white LEDs, rosy pink prints), make sure they coordinate with your textiles—throw pillows, duvet and rugs—to avoid a disjointed look.
Compare alternatives: full-service framed art and heavy lighting installations offer permanence but demand commitment and money. These budget options let you experiment rapidly and swap pieces seasonally. Finally, read product Q&A and verified buyer photos to gauge real-world size, adhesion strength, and color temperature—these small practicalities can make or break an installation.
